Teaching English as a Second or Foreign Language/ESL Language Instructor at MidlandU

MidlandU granted 46 degrees in teaching english as a second or foreign language/esl language instructor in the most recent reporting year — 85% to women and 15% to men. The largest share of these graduates were White (80%). This count includes degrees completed through distance education.
